Elagabalus, 218-222. Antoninianus (Silver, 23 mm, 4.75 g, 12 h), Rome, 218-219. IMP CAES M AVR ANTONINVS AVG Radiate, draped and cuirassed bust of Elagabalus to right, seen from behind. Rev. MARS VICTOR Mars advancing right, holding spear in his right hand and trophy over his left shoulder. BMC 17. Cohen 113. RIC 122. Thirion 41. Slightly rough, otherwise, about extremely fine.
